Same-Sex Marriage Ruling Stands


OTTAWA, OCT. 9, 2003 (Zenit.org).- Pro-family groups lost a major battle in their struggle against same-sex marriage when Canada's highest court rejected their bid to appeal a lower court decision, the Globe and Mail reported.

A five-judge Supreme Court of Canada panel ruled unanimously that the Association for Marriage and the Family in Ontario and the Interfaith Coalition on Marriage and Family cannot appeal a judgment by the Ontario Court of Appeal that found the traditional definition of marriage to be unconstitutional, the newspaper said.

In the new year, the Liberal government likely will introduce legislation to allow same-sex marriage.
